These three get compared as equivalents. They are not. Two are offline renderers and one is a real-time application, which makes most published comparisons quietly incoherent.

The short answer
They are not equivalents: V-Ray and Corona are offline renderers, Lumion is a real-time application, which makes most published comparisons incoherent. V-Ray is the broadest — many hosts, highest ceiling, and the only one of the three that runs on a Mac. Corona wins for interiors specifically, because its out-of-the-box lighting behaviour suits bounced and mixed light, but it lives in 3ds Max and Cinema 4D. Lumion is fastest to a decent image and strongest on exterior and landscape context, with the least control.
V-Ray
The industry standard, and the broadest. It plugs into SketchUp, Rhino, 3ds Max, Revit and more, and it runs natively on Mac — which alone rules the other two out for a lot of studios.
The ceiling is as high as any renderer available. So is the amount you can misconfigure. V-Ray rewards knowing what you are doing and punishes guessing, which is why the same engine produces both the best and the worst images in most portfolios.
Corona
Corona's reputation among interior artists is real and it comes down to defaults. Its out-of-the-box behaviour suits interior lighting — bounced light, warm sources, mixed daylight and artificial — unusually well, so you spend less time fighting to a plausible image.
For interiors specifically, many artists reach a good result faster in Corona than in V-Ray. The catch for Mac studios is fatal: Corona runs through 3ds Max, and 3ds Max is Windows only.
Lumion, and why it does not belong here
Lumion is a real-time application built around exteriors, landscape and context. Enormous vegetation libraries, weather, seasons, populated scenes. For a building in its setting it is excellent and very fast.
For a bathroom, it is the wrong tool. Not incapable — wrong. The engine's strengths are all outside the window.
If you want real-time for interiors, the comparison you actually want is Enscape against Twinmotion, not this one.
What each one asks of your computer
The engine you choose is also a hardware decision, and the three ask for completely different machines. Buying the wrong one first is how studios end up with an expensive graphics card that their renderer never touches.
| Engine | Renders on | So the money goes into |
|---|---|---|
| V-Ray | CPU, GPU or both | Either — the flexible choice if you have not decided |
| Corona | CPU only | Processor cores and system memory. A graphics card does nothing for it. |
| Lumion | GPU, in real time | A strong card with generous memory, and a Windows machine to put it in |
Corona’s position surprises people most often, because its interior results are the reason many studios chose it and they are produced entirely on the processor. The wider explanation is in GPU vs CPU rendering — but the short version is that card memory, not card speed, is what stops a render, and Corona sidesteps that question altogether.
Choosing
- On a Mac — V-Ray. The decision is made.
- Windows, interiors, want results fast — Corona.
- Windows, mixed interior and exterior, maximum control — V-Ray.
- Mostly exteriors and context — Lumion, and it is the right tool.
The caveat that matters more than the choice
The engine is not what makes a render good. Lighting decisions, material accuracy, camera height and styling account for almost all of the difference between a convincing image and an obviously computed one.
